    We bought our first Mac last year (a Macbook) and I have to say I've been real impressed with it so far. I had some reservations about it at first (I was a big PC gamer), but most games I like for the PC I can play on the Macbook with Crossover Games or Parallels Windows which allows you to run windows on your system. I however, would recommend getting something with at least 4 GB Memory if you choose to run Parallels so you can run both smoothly, I only have 2 GB on the Macbook and it runs well for normal office stuff, but games (Spore, CS in my case) don't run as smoothly as I'd like it too on the 1 GB shared RAM.

    Anyways, PC vs. Mac is entirely a personal preference and I'm sure either choice will be a good decision considering it will be brand new. Macs can be pricey though for what you could comparably get on a Windows based Laptop which is always important to take into consideration.
